Some of these artists are a little less well known: Max Raabe and The Palast Orchestra is a 1920's-esque German orchestra that remakes contemporary songs. How can you not love that?!? The Pierces are this totally amazing sister duo and I'm seriously obsessed with every song on their recent album, "Thirteen Tales of Love and Revenge". Jingo is this band I discovered after buying the soundtrack to "The Last King of Scotland" and they have quickly become one of my favorite all-time artists.
